Pay attention to the fit more than the label
When shopping for jeans, do not focus so much on the label on the jeans. Rather pay more attention to the actual fit of the jeans. This is because; there is not universal standard when it comes to jeans designs. While the label on the jeans may provide useful information about the design and the size of the jeans, these facts vary from one manufacturer to another. Hence, you may find that you wear a size 10 on some jeans and a size 14 on others. That is why you should not go by the label on the jeans.
